From this mornings Ottawa Sun.
The Senators are moving closer to a deal with RW Chris Neil, but there are no guarantees something will be done before he becomes an unrestricted free agent on July 1. Murray and Neil’s agent, Todd Reynolds, were scheduled to have more discussions yesterday to try to keep the rugged winger in Ottawa next season. “I talked to them over the weekend. I have a planned phone call and I’m just going to see if it makes any difference or not,” said Murray. Neil said last night his No. 1 goal is “to stay in Ottawa” and he was waiting for an update to see where discussions stand. He made $1.1 million (all terms US) last year and indications are the Senators have offered a thee-year deal worth $1.7 million per-season. If Neil, who is believed to be seeking a long-term contract, does decide to test the open market, he’s going to get plenty of interest — including a bid from the Toronto Maple Leafs. “I haven’t really thought about waiting until July 1. I want to get something done here,” said Neil.
